Professional ethics and accountability are fundamental principles that guide the behavior of teachers and other professionals in their respective fields. These principles help to ensure that professionals are acting in the best interests of their clients, students, or patients, and are upholding their responsibilities to their profession and society as a whole.

As a teacher, it is essential to adhere to professional ethics in order to maintain the trust and respect of your students, colleagues, and the wider community. This includes being honest, respectful, and fair in all interactions, as well as maintaining confidentiality when appropriate. It also involves being accountable for your actions, which means taking responsibility for your mistakes and striving to continually improve your practice.

One key aspect of professional ethics for teachers is the principle of non-maleficence, which means avoiding harm to students. This means that teachers should strive to create a safe and inclusive learning environment, and be mindful of any potential negative impacts their actions may have on their students. Teachers should also be aware of their own biases and work to overcome them, in order to avoid discriminating against or marginalizing any students.

Another important aspect of professional ethics for teachers is the principle of beneficence, which means actively working to promote the well-being and success of their students. This includes providing high-quality instruction, supporting students in their learning, and advocating for their needs. Teachers should also seek out professional development opportunities to improve their own skills and knowledge, in order to better serve their students.

In addition to upholding professional ethics, teachers are also accountable to their colleagues, school or district leadership, and the wider community. This includes being transparent and open about their practices, and being willing to accept feedback and make changes when necessary. It also involves adhering to professional standards and guidelines set by governing bodies, such as state teaching licensure requirements and district policies.

Overall, professional ethics and accountability are critical for teachers to maintain the trust and respect of their students, colleagues, and the wider community. By upholding these principles, teachers can ensure that they are providing the best possible education for their students and contributing to the overall success of their profession.
